About Mathis Stock
Mathis Stock is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Archeology, Tourism, Leisure and Hospitality Management, Urban Studies and Cultural Studies, having authored 46 papers that have together received 520 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include French Urban and Social Studies (30 papers), Cultural Identity and Heritage (16 papers), Diverse Aspects of Tourism Research (12 papers), Migration, Aging, and Tourism Studies (5 papers), Wine Industry and Tourism (5 papers), Education, sociology, and vocational training (4 papers), Cultural Industries and Urban Development (4 papers) and Cruise Tourism Development and Management (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Tourism, Leisure and Hospitality Management (83 citations), Geography, Planning and Development (63 citations), Sociology and Political Science (426 citations), Transportation (65 citations) and Archeology (96 citations). Mathis Stock has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land, France and Bulgaria. Frequent co-authors include Frédéric Darbellay, Rémy Knafou, Philippe Duhamel, Stéphane Nahrath, Isabelle Sacareau, Philippe Violier, Olivier Dehoorne, Monika Salzbrunn, Nathalie Ortar and Olivier Crevoisier. Their work appears in journals such as Annals of Tourism Research, Progress in Human Geography, Geographische Zeitschrift, Annales de Géographie and BELGEO.
